Swartz MS, Swanson JW, Wagner HR, et al . Can involuntary outpatient commitment reduce hospital recidivism?: Findings from a randomized trial with severely mentally ill individuals. Am J Psychiatry 1999 Dec;156:1968–75.QUESTIONS: In patients with severe mental illness, is involuntary outpatient commitment effective in reducing rehospitalisations and is effectiveness dependent on a sustained exposure to court ordered treatment? For what clinical groups is involuntary commitment most effective?
